Report: Lions' Ragnow to undergo season-ending toe surgery

Detroit Lions center Frank Ragnow will undergo season-ending toe surgery, sources told NFL Network's Ian Rapoport.

The Lions placed Ragnow on injured reserve after Week 4, sidelining him for a minimum of three games. One of the NFL's top centers, Ragnow made his first Pro Bowl in 2020.

Detroit has dealt with injuries along the offensive line throughout the early portion of the schedule. Left tackle Taylor Decker could return from a hand injury in Week 6, which would allow rookie Penei Sewell to swing to the right side.

Before the season, Ragnow signed a four-year, $54-million extension with the Lions that runs through the 2026 season.
